The absence of authentic Maine-style lobster rolls in New York City inspired native Mainer (and son of a former lobsterman) Luke Holden to set up shop in 2009. Each toasted bun (split-top, of course) comes loaded with a quarter-pound of lobster meat that’s sustainably sourced and processed at a sister facility in Maine. The natural sweetness of the lobster shines through in every bite, balanced simply with a squirt of mayo, slick of lemon butter and sprinkling of seasoning.
